Definition

Title for a female royal figure, primarily denoting a queen or royal consort—typically the wife of a reigning king. In certain contexts, can refer to a woman possessing sovereign authority in her own right or, rarely, to a female deity addressed with a royal title.

Semantic Range

queen consort, queen regnant, female royal figure, (rarely) female deity addressed as queen

Root / Etymology

From the Hebrew root מָלַךְ (mlk), meaning 'to reign, to be king/queen.' The form מְלֶכֶת is a feminine noun, constructed with the feminine ending -ֶת (usually appearing as -et), signifying a female ruler or consort.

Historical & Contextual Notes

In biblical usage, מְלֶכֶת usually refers to a human queen, often the consort of a king (e.g., the Queen of Sheba in 1 Kings 10:1). Occasionally, it appears in phrases denoting female deities (e.g., 'queen of heaven' in Jeremiah 7:18), reflecting Canaanite or Mesopotamian religious influence, and not referring to Israelites or Judahites. During the monarchic period, the term applied to royal women who held political or ceremonial prominence; later, it sometimes bore a more independent sense of female rulership. English translations often render it simply as 'queen,' but this can obscure the distinction between a queen regnant (sovereign in her own right) and queen consort (king's wife). The comparable masculine form is מֶלֶךְ (king), while other words for royal women (e.g., גְּבִירָה) carry slightly different connotations, often emphasizing status or authority apart from direct marriage to the king. The title's use for deities is distinctively non-Israelite in context, and later traditions sometimes collapse this nuance by simply translating as 'queen.'
